Software extensions, commonly referred to as plugins, frequently require a process of formal introduction to the host application. This introduction, or registration, is often facilitated by specialized utilities. The acquisition of these utilities, generally involving a digital transfer of data from a server to a local machine, is essential for the proper integration and functionality of the plugin within its intended environment. A specific instance involves adding a new audio effect to a digital audio workstation, requiring a procedure initiated by obtaining the appropriate registration component.
The availability of these utilities directly impacts the user’s ability to expand the capabilities of their software. Access to and utilization of such registration components are vital for ensuring compatibility, stability, and optimal performance of the extended functionality. Historically, these tools have evolved from simple command-line interfaces to more sophisticated graphical user interfaces, streamlining the integration process for end-users and developers alike, while enhancing security and version control measures.
Understanding the purpose, benefits, and proper usage of these utilities is therefore crucial for maximizing the potential of compatible software. Subsequent sections will delve into the specifics of obtaining, installing, and effectively utilizing these registration tools, alongside a discussion of associated best practices and troubleshooting techniques.
1. Legitimate Source Verification
The process of acquiring a “plugin registration tool download” is intrinsically linked to legitimate source verification. The origin of the downloaded file directly influences the security and stability of the software environment. Downloading from unverified or dubious sources elevates the risk of introducing malicious software, such as viruses, trojans, or spyware, disguised as the intended registration utility. This infiltration can compromise system integrity, expose sensitive data, and disrupt operational functionality. For example, a user seeking to install a video editing plugin might inadvertently download a compromised installer from a file-sharing website, leading to a ransomware infection.
The importance of legitimate source verification extends beyond mere malware prevention. It also ensures the authenticity and integrity of the “plugin registration tool download” itself. A modified or tampered-with registration utility might fail to properly register the plugin, leading to functionality issues or system instability. Conversely, an authentic registration tool, sourced directly from the plugin developer or a trusted software repository, guarantees compatibility and seamless integration. This process reduces the likelihood of errors, conflicts, and performance degradation. Consider the instance where a design professional downloads a Photoshop plugin registration utility from Adobe’s official website; this guarantees that the tool is correctly designed and compatible with the software, minimizing the potential for workflow disruptions.
In conclusion, legitimate source verification represents a critical step in the “plugin registration tool download” process. Prioritizing trusted sources mitigates security risks, guarantees utility integrity, and ultimately contributes to a stable and secure software environment. Neglecting this verification can result in severe consequences, ranging from data breaches to system failures, underscoring the practical significance of adhering to secure download practices.
2. Version Compatibility Assessment
Version compatibility assessment is a critical prerequisite to any “plugin registration tool download.” The tool employed to register a software extension must be specifically designed to interact with the target application’s version. Mismatched versions can lead to registration failures, application instability, or even system-level errors. This interdependency arises from the fact that application programming interfaces (APIs) and internal structures often evolve between software versions. A registration tool built for an older API may not be able to correctly interface with a newer application, resulting in a breakdown of communication and integration processes. For instance, attempting to register a plugin designed for Adobe Photoshop CS6 using a registration tool intended for Photoshop 2023 will likely result in registration failure due to API changes and structural incompatibilities.
The consequences of neglecting version compatibility extend beyond simple registration failures. Using an incompatible registration tool can corrupt application configuration files or introduce unforeseen system vulnerabilities. The tool might attempt to write data in an incorrect format or location, leading to data loss or application malfunction. Conversely, the application might misinterpret the registration tool’s instructions, leading to unpredictable behavior. Software developers mitigate these risks by providing specific registration tools for each compatible application version, often including version identifiers in the tool’s filename or description. This practice facilitates accurate selection and reduces the likelihood of compatibility-related issues. Consider the case of a user who inadvertently uses a Microsoft Office 2010 plugin registration tool with Office 365. The outcome may involve the creation of erroneous registry entries, compromising the stability and functionality of the Office 365 suite.
In summary, the necessity of version compatibility assessment before undertaking a “plugin registration tool download” cannot be overstated. Selecting a tool designed for the specific version of the target application is paramount to ensure successful registration, prevent application instability, and avoid potential system-level errors. Adherence to this principle represents a fundamental element of responsible software management and contributes significantly to maintaining a stable and secure computing environment. The risks associated with ignoring version compatibility far outweigh any perceived time savings gained by skipping this crucial assessment.
3. Digital Signature Validation
Digital signature validation plays a pivotal role in the secure acquisition of a “plugin registration tool download.” It serves as a cryptographic mechanism ensuring the authenticity and integrity of the downloaded file. A digital signature, akin to a digital fingerprint, is uniquely associated with the software developer or distributor. This signature is appended to the registration tool and can be verified using cryptographic keys. If the signature is valid, it confirms that the tool originated from the claimed source and has not been tampered with during transit. Failure to validate the digital signature introduces the risk of installing a malicious or corrupted registration tool, which can compromise system security and functionality. For example, a security-conscious enterprise mandates digital signature verification for all software installations to prevent the introduction of rogue code into its network.
The practical application of digital signature validation occurs during the download and installation process. Modern operating systems and software management tools often automatically verify digital signatures before allowing a file to execute. When a user attempts a “plugin registration tool download,” the system checks the file’s signature against a trusted certificate authority. If the signature is invalid or missing, the system issues a warning or prevents the installation altogether. This preventative measure safeguards against various threats, including man-in-the-middle attacks and software supply chain compromises. An illustrative scenario involves a user attempting to install a plugin for a graphics editor. If the downloaded registration tool lacks a valid digital signature, the operating system will display a security alert, urging the user to reconsider the installation. This alert serves as a critical line of defense against potential malware infections.
In conclusion, digital signature validation is an indispensable security measure intertwined with the “plugin registration tool download” process. Its importance lies in verifying the authenticity and integrity of the registration tool, mitigating the risks associated with malicious or corrupted software. While not foolproof, digital signature validation provides a robust layer of protection against software-based threats, contributing to a more secure and trustworthy software ecosystem. The challenge lies in educating users about the significance of digital signatures and ensuring that systems are configured to properly enforce signature validation policies.
4. Secure Download Protocols
The integrity and security of a “plugin registration tool download” are intrinsically linked to the utilization of secure download protocols. These protocols, most notably HTTPS (Hypertext Transfer Protocol Secure), establish an encrypted communication channel between the server hosting the registration tool and the user’s computer. This encryption prevents eavesdropping and tampering during the download process, safeguarding the tool from malicious modifications or the injection of malware. The absence of secure download protocols exposes the download process to significant vulnerabilities, potentially compromising the user’s system. For example, a man-in-the-middle attack could intercept a registration tool downloaded via an unencrypted HTTP connection, replacing it with a compromised version that installs malware alongside the intended plugin.
The implementation of HTTPS, as a secure download protocol, involves the use of SSL/TLS (Secure Sockets Layer/Transport Layer Security) certificates. These certificates authenticate the server hosting the registration tool, verifying its identity and preventing impersonation attempts. A valid SSL/TLS certificate assures the user that they are indeed downloading the tool from the legitimate source and not a fraudulent website. Furthermore, the encrypted connection established by HTTPS protects sensitive information, such as download credentials or system details, from being intercepted by unauthorized parties. Consider a scenario where a software developer provides a “plugin registration tool download” via HTTPS. The user’s browser verifies the server’s SSL/TLS certificate, establishing a secure connection that protects the download from interception or tampering.
In conclusion, the adoption of secure download protocols is a fundamental security practice for “plugin registration tool download”. HTTPS, with its encryption and server authentication capabilities, provides a crucial layer of protection against malicious attacks and ensures the integrity of the downloaded tool. Neglecting secure download protocols elevates the risk of malware infections, data breaches, and system compromises. Therefore, prioritizing downloads from sources utilizing HTTPS and verifying the validity of SSL/TLS certificates are essential steps in maintaining a secure and trustworthy software environment.
5. System Requirements Adherence
Adherence to system requirements constitutes a fundamental aspect of a successful “plugin registration tool download” and subsequent execution. Disregarding these requirements can lead to registration failures, application instability, or complete system malfunction. The interplay between hardware and software components necessitates strict adherence to the specified minimum and recommended configurations outlined by the plugin and registration tool developers.
-
Operating System Compatibility
The “plugin registration tool download” mandates strict adherence to the specified operating system (OS) compatibility. The registration tool must be specifically designed for the OS on which it is intended to operate. Mismatched OS compatibility can result in installation failures, system errors, or security vulnerabilities. For instance, a registration tool designed for Windows 10 may not function correctly, or at all, on a macOS or Linux environment. Furthermore, specific OS versions (e.g., Windows 10 version 22H2) might be prerequisites for the registration tool to function optimally, taking advantage of specific OS features or libraries.
-
Hardware Specifications (CPU, RAM, Storage)
Minimum hardware specifications, including central processing unit (CPU) speed, random-access memory (RAM) capacity, and available storage space, directly influence the successful execution of a “plugin registration tool download.” Insufficient CPU power can result in slow processing and extended registration times. Inadequate RAM can lead to system crashes or memory errors during the registration process. Insufficient storage space can prevent the registration tool from being installed or from creating necessary temporary files. As an example, attempting to execute a resource-intensive plugin registration on a system with a low-end CPU and limited RAM might result in the registration process timing out or failing to complete successfully.
-
Software Dependencies (Libraries, Frameworks)
Many “plugin registration tool download” processes rely on specific software dependencies, such as runtime libraries or software frameworks. These dependencies provide essential functions and components required for the registration tool to operate correctly. Failure to have these dependencies installed or having outdated versions can lead to runtime errors, unexpected behavior, or registration failures. For example, a registration tool might require the Microsoft .NET Framework version 4.8 to be installed. If the system only has an older version of the .NET Framework, the registration tool might fail to start or encounter errors during the registration process.
-
Administrator Privileges
The “plugin registration tool download” frequently requires administrator privileges for proper installation and execution. Administrator privileges grant the registration tool the necessary permissions to modify system files, registry entries, or other protected resources. Without these privileges, the registration tool might be unable to complete the registration process successfully, leading to errors or incomplete installations. An example of this is when a registration tool needs to write information to the Windows Registry under the HKEY_LOCAL_MACHINE hive; this requires elevated privileges that a standard user account does not possess.
In summation, ensuring strict adherence to all system requirements is paramount before initiating a “plugin registration tool download.” Failure to do so can result in a cascade of issues, ranging from simple installation errors to critical system instability. Prioritizing system compatibility and fulfilling all specified hardware and software prerequisites are essential steps in ensuring a smooth and successful plugin registration process.
6. Installation Process Integrity
Installation Process Integrity is paramount to the successful integration of software extensions following a “plugin registration tool download.” A compromised installation jeopardizes the functionality, security, and stability of both the plugin and the host application. Any disruption or corruption during this phase can lead to incomplete registration, system errors, or vulnerabilities exploitable by malicious actors.
-
Uninterrupted Installation Execution
The execution of the installation process for a “plugin registration tool download” must proceed without interruption. Premature termination due to power outages, system crashes, or user intervention can result in corrupted files or incomplete registry entries. Such incomplete installations often lead to unpredictable behavior, ranging from minor glitches to critical system failures. For instance, if the system loses power midway through the installation, the tool might not be properly registered within the operating system, requiring a complete reinstallation to rectify the issue.
-
Verification of File Integrity
Verifying the integrity of downloaded files is crucial prior to and following the installation of a “plugin registration tool download.” File corruption, caused by faulty network transmission or storage errors, can lead to installation failures or introduce vulnerabilities into the system. Checksum verification, using tools like MD5 or SHA-256, ensures that the downloaded file matches the original source, confirming its uncorrupted state. A mismatch between the calculated checksum and the published checksum indicates a compromised file, requiring a re-download from a trusted source.
-
Adherence to Installation Instructions
Strict adherence to the installation instructions provided by the software developer is essential for maintaining installation process integrity for a “plugin registration tool download.” Deviation from these instructions can lead to improper configuration, file placement errors, or compatibility issues. The instructions typically outline the correct sequence of steps, required dependencies, and specific settings to ensure proper integration. Ignoring these guidelines, such as installing the tool in an incorrect directory, might result in the plugin failing to function as intended or causing conflicts with other software components.
-
Appropriate User Permissions
Ensuring appropriate user permissions during the installation process for a “plugin registration tool download” is vital for preventing unauthorized access and maintaining system security. Administrator privileges are often required to modify system files, registry entries, or other protected resources. Granting excessive permissions or failing to restrict access appropriately can create vulnerabilities that malicious actors can exploit. Installing a registration tool with standard user privileges when administrator access is required might lead to incomplete installation, limiting the tool’s functionality or creating security loopholes within the system.
In conclusion, meticulous attention to Installation Process Integrity is indispensable for realizing the full potential and security benefits of a “plugin registration tool download.” These multifaceted considerations, spanning uninterrupted execution, file integrity verification, instructional adherence, and proper permission management, are paramount for ensuring a stable, secure, and functional software environment. Neglecting any of these aspects increases the risk of compromising system integrity and functionality, thereby negating the intended benefits of the plugin.
Frequently Asked Questions
This section addresses common inquiries and misconceptions regarding the process of obtaining and utilizing plugin registration tools. These questions aim to clarify essential aspects, ensuring a secure and efficient user experience.
Question 1: What constitutes a “plugin registration tool download”?
It refers to the act of acquiring a software utility specifically designed to formally integrate a plugin or extension with its host application. This utility typically handles tasks such as verifying license information, configuring plugin settings, and establishing communication channels between the plugin and the main program. This action facilitates the proper functionality of the plugin within its intended environment.
Question 2: Why is a dedicated registration tool necessary for some plugins?
Not all plugins require a dedicated tool. However, those with complex licensing schemes, intricate configuration requirements, or dependencies on specific system resources often necessitate a registration utility. The utility streamlines the integration process, ensuring that all necessary components are correctly installed and configured. This measure prevents errors and ensures optimal performance of the plugin.
Question 3: What are the potential risks associated with downloading a plugin registration tool?
Acquiring registration tools from unverified sources poses significant security risks. Malicious actors may distribute counterfeit tools containing malware, spyware, or other harmful software. These threats can compromise system security, steal sensitive data, or disrupt normal operations. Always prioritize downloads from the plugin developer’s official website or a trusted software repository.
Question 4: How can the legitimacy of a “plugin registration tool download” be verified?
Several measures can be employed to verify the legitimacy of a downloaded tool. Check the digital signature of the file to ensure it is signed by a trusted publisher. Verify the file’s checksum against the value provided by the developer. Scan the file with a reputable antivirus program. Download the tool from the official source, eliminating the risk of encountering a manipulated version.
Question 5: What steps should be taken if a “plugin registration tool download” fails?
Troubleshooting download failures requires a systematic approach. First, verify the internet connection. Second, ensure that the system meets the minimum requirements specified by the developer. Third, temporarily disable any firewalls or antivirus software that might be interfering with the download. Fourth, attempt to download the file using a different web browser. If all else fails, contact the plugin developer’s support team for assistance.
Question 6: What are the legal considerations associated with using a “plugin registration tool download”?
The use of a registration tool is typically governed by the end-user license agreement (EULA) associated with the plugin. It is imperative to review the EULA to understand the terms of use, restrictions, and limitations. Unauthorized distribution or modification of the registration tool may violate copyright laws and constitute a breach of contract. Ensure that the tool is used in accordance with the EULA stipulations.
The importance of secure download practices and thorough verification procedures cannot be overstated when acquiring and utilizing plugin registration tools. These steps contribute significantly to a stable and secure software ecosystem.
The subsequent section will delve into specific troubleshooting techniques for common registration issues.
Plugin Registration Tool Download
The process of acquiring and utilizing plugin registration tools requires careful attention to detail. The following tips address critical aspects to ensure a secure and efficient experience.
Tip 1: Prioritize Official Sources: Obtain the registration tool directly from the plugin developer’s website or a reputable software repository. This practice minimizes the risk of downloading compromised or malicious software.
Tip 2: Verify Digital Signatures: Before executing the downloaded file, validate its digital signature. A valid signature confirms the authenticity of the tool and ensures that it has not been tampered with since its creation.
Tip 3: Scan for Malware: Employ a reputable antivirus or antimalware program to scan the downloaded file before installation. This preemptive measure detects and eliminates potential threats before they can compromise the system.
Tip 4: Assess System Compatibility: Verify that the registration tool is compatible with the operating system and hardware configuration. Incompatible tools may cause installation failures or system instability.
Tip 5: Follow Installation Instructions Precisely: Adhere to the installation instructions provided by the developer. Deviations from the recommended procedure may lead to improper configuration and functionality issues.
Tip 6: Maintain Administrator Privileges: Ensure that the installation process is executed with administrator privileges. These privileges are often necessary to modify system files and registry entries, enabling proper plugin integration.
Tip 7: Create a System Backup: Before initiating the installation process, create a system backup or restore point. This precaution allows for a quick recovery in the event of unforeseen complications or system errors.
The consistent application of these tips will significantly reduce the risks associated with plugin registration and contribute to a more secure and stable software environment.
The subsequent section will provide a comprehensive conclusion to the subject matter, summarizing key recommendations and emphasizing the importance of responsible software management.
Plugin Registration Tool Download
This exploration of the “plugin registration tool download” process highlights its critical role in extending software functionality while underscoring the inherent risks involved. Vigilance concerning source verification, digital signature validation, and adherence to system requirements remains paramount. Failure to prioritize these safeguards can lead to system compromise, data breaches, and operational disruption. The seemingly simple act of acquiring a software utility, therefore, demands a degree of scrutiny commensurate with the potential consequences.
The long-term stability and security of any software environment depend on a proactive and informed approach to managing plugin integrations. By embracing these principles and diligently applying the recommended best practices, users can mitigate the risks associated with the “plugin registration tool download” and ensure a safer, more reliable computing experience. Ongoing diligence and awareness, not complacency, represent the path toward minimizing future vulnerabilities in an ever-evolving technological landscape.